This study is about using advanced imaging techniques to map the epileptogenic zone (the brain area causing seizures) in kids under 18 with certain types of epilepsy. **Epilepsy** is a condition where people have seizures. SEEG (stereoelectroencephalography) is a traditional test that uses electrodes on the brain, but it's invasive. Researchers want to see if combining ASL-MRI (arterial spin-labeling MRI) and resting-state fMRI (functional MRI) with EEG (electroencephalogram) can map this zone more precisely without needing SEEG. EEG records brain activity, while MRI scans show detailed brain images. Kids in the study need to have focal lesional epilepsy (seizures from a specific brain area) or rare non-lesional epilepsy (seizures without a visible brain lesion). They shouldn't need anesthesia for the MRI, have generalized epilepsy (seizures affecting the whole brain), or be under legal restrictions.
